Kelly McCants is the writer of the blog Oilcloth Addict. You cannot imagine how many things can be sewed with oilcloth. She has just published a book that can be purchased at her shop on Etsy, where she also sells precious printed oilcloths. At her other shop, Modern June, you will find products made by her.
